Khimki Moscow Region got the job done with ease and registered their second win for the season.

By Eurohoops team/ info@eurohoops.net

Alexey Shved scored 22 points and dished seven assists to go along with seven rebounds, Jordan Mickey added 17 points and Khimki Moscow Region got the 85-69 win over Buducnost VOLI.

Despite a bad start in the season, the hosts were on paper the better team and proved it beyond any doubt. After a competitive first period which ended with the hosts leading by one (18-17), the half time score was 45-30 for Giorgos Bartzokas’ team and the game was over. Thanks to a 16-7 partial score (34-24) Khimki got a 10-point advantage and pretty much kept it until the end.

I think the ratio of our assists and turnovers was the key. We had 21 assists and 8 turnovers. That means we had creativity. We controlled the game for 40 minutes through our defense“, said coach Bartzokas after the end of the game.

Buducnost tried its best, but Khimki was leading by eleven at the start of the last quarter (65-54). Earl Clark with 19 points and Alen Omic with 10 scored in double-digits for Buducnost, but were not a factor in the game.

As Bartzokas explained: “Everyone knew it was a must-win game for us. I want would like to give credit to Tony Corker and Charles Jenkins who played despite their injuries. They were not ready to play, but they gave everything and I appreciate it. We will have to play much better against Zalgiris. When you have injured players it is not easy to play for 40 minutes at the same high level. We were maybe loose, watching at the score. We have to improve on that, but we won, which was the important thing today.

It was an uneventful game which will be remembered mainly for this unusual play.  Stefan Markovic threw the pass to Jordan Mickey who made a basket using his head.
